Orange Poppy Seed Shortbread

Source: CHEF
Ingredients
1 ¼ c. all purpose flour
3 tbsp. sugar
½ c. butter
1 tbsp. poppy seeds
1 tsp. finely chopped orange zest
½ tsp. vanilla extract
Directions
Combine flour and sugar. Cut in butter and poppy seeds. The key is to form fine crumbs, not mix these ingredients entirely. When it forms fine crumbs add the zest and vanilla and knead into a smooth dough. On an ungreased cookie sheet, roll the dough into an 8” circle. Press pointer finger and thumb around other thumb on edge of the dough to make a scalloped edge making a wave like pattern; or take a fork and make gentle indentations around the outer edge. Cut the circle into 16 pie shaped wedges. Leave the wedges in a circle and bake at 325 degrees Fahrenheit until the bottom just begins to brown. Cool for 5 minutes in a cookie sheet, and then transfer to a wire rack to complete cooling. Break apart into pie shaped cookies and serve (excellent with Orange Scented Drinking Chocolate).
